Neat piece of light purple glass found along an abandoned rail bed in southeastern Arizona. Probably turned from the sun. The diameter of the lower portion of the inside of this item is two inches exactly. The heighth of the lower inner part is an inch and an eighth. Looks like the diameter of the lip at the top was about 1.5 inches. There is a very weak embossing on the bottom and inside. Looks like a "1" in a circle. Inkwell? Any other ideas?
